Form 4: Howard Hughes Holdings Director, Mary Ann Tighe, Reports Stock Grant and Indirect Ownership
SEC Form 4 Filing
Mary Ann Tighe, a director of Howard Hughes Holdings Inc., reported the acquisition of restricted stock and indirect ownership of shares held by her husband.
Summary
- On June 14, 2024, Mary Ann Tighe, a director of Howard Hughes Holdings Inc., reported a transaction involving the company's stock.
- She acquired 3,268 shares of common stock as restricted stock granted under the company's 2020 Equity Incentive Plan.
- These shares vest on the earlier of the 2025 annual meeting of stockholders or June 1, 2025.
- Tighe also reported indirect beneficial ownership of 19,495 shares held by her husband.
